The Dodgers' bullpen scoreless streak ended at 38 innings when Kyle Hurt allowed a solo home run to Ezequiel Tovar.
A four-run rally in the seventh inning, highlighted by Freddie Freeman's go-ahead RBI double, secured the win for the Dodgers.
Kiké Hernández had a productive night, going 2-for-2 with an RBI double before being pinch-hit for in the seventh.
The Rockies' Tanner Gordon pitched well, but the bullpen couldn't hold the lead.
The Dodgers' victory over the Rockies was a tale of two pitching performances and a late-inning surge. Emmet Sheehan delivered a quality start, while the Rockies' Tanner Gordon also pitched effectively. However, the Rockies' bullpen faltered in the seventh, allowing the Dodgers to capitalize and take the lead.
The Dodgers' offense, which had been struggling with runners in scoring position, finally broke through in the seventh. Key hits from Shohei Ohtani, Mookie Betts, Freddie Freeman, and Andy Pages drove in the runs needed to secure the win. The bullpen, led by Will Klein, Alex Vesia, and Blake Treinen, shut down the Rockies in the final innings to preserve the victory.
Kiké Hernández's performance also deserves recognition. His early RBI double helped the Dodgers get on the board, and his overall offensive contribution was valuable.
